Catalog description

This course offers an engaging exploration of Italian pop culture, through the lens of visual arts, cinema, music, contemporary media, and other cultural expressions. Students identify major trends that have shaped contemporary Italian culture, from popular films, to music, comics, sports and fashion. Through critical analysis, students apply cultural concepts to examine how these representations reflect and respond to Italy’s historical, social and political contexts. The course allows students to contrast Italian popular culture with other world regions. Additionally, students investigate the global impact of Italian pop culture, exploring how Italian creativity has influenced and been reinterpreted across the world.
